"Storage SATA Solution: Sonnet Announces Fusion R400Q Rack Mount SATA Drive Enclosure; 4-Bay, 1U Enclosure Features Quad Interface And SATA Port Multiplier

Sonnet Technologies, one of the leader in upgrades for Apple Mac computers and iPod mobile digital devices, announced Fusion R400Q, the addition to its line of acclaimed Serial ATA drive enclosures. This 13.5" deep, 4-bay rack mount drive enclosure provides unmatched flexibility—with four interface choices—FireWire 400, FireWire 800, USB 2.0, or for ultimate performance, SATA II. An integrated port multiplier supports up to four hard drives through any of the connections.

Fusion R400Q's hot-swappable 3.5" drive trays enable quick addition and swapping of storage on the fly. Users can install a single drive to start, add drives as needed, and purchase additional trays and drives to build a backup archive. Users can add the drives they want at a cost they can afford. With ever-increasing drive capacities and frequent drops in cost per gigabyte, Fusion R400Q is an intelligent alternative to populated enclosures.

This attractive enclosure's form factor allows it to be used in a wide range of applications. Its depth enables it to be used in the shortest portable racks, while its 1U height takes up minimal rack space. Four Fusion R400Qs can be handled with Sonnet's four-port SATA host bus adapters—the Tempo SATA E4P or Tempo SATA X4P. When configured in striped RAID 0 set, data transfer rates up to 200MB/s per 4-drive set are possible. This enclosure is a perfect companion for Xserve, yet is platform-independent, making it compatible with most servers.

Fusion R400Q includes drive mounting hardware for each of its four included drive trays, and a cable for each interface. Its trays are interchangeable with Sonnet's Fusion 400 and Fusion 500P desktop SATA drive enclosures.

KEY FEATURES

  • 1U rack mount enclosure with 4 hot-swappable 3.5" drive trays
  • SATA II compliant; 3.0 Gb/s and 1.5 Gb/s auto-negotiation
  • Quad interface—eSATA, FireWire 800, FireWire 400, and USB 2.0
  • Built-in SATA II port multiplier for one cable to host for all connection types
  • Universal 90–260V, 50-60Hz power supply
  • Drive Activity, Drive Presence, and Power LED indicators on front panel
  • Front panel power switch
  • Platform independent—works with Mac, Windows or Linux servers
